How to Use a Nebulizer Mask
Nebulizer face masks allow a patient to inhale medication that's been turned into a fine mist. Usually, this medicine reduces swelling in the bronchial tubes and makes it easier to breathe. You can customize the fit of a nebulizer face mask by bending the metal bar across the nose and adjusting the elastic band.
Instructions
-
-
1
Place the mask on your face with the elastic band going around the back of your head.
-
2
Pull the ends of the elastic bands on either side of the mask make the mask looser or tighter. The mask should fit snugly in place without being painful.
-
-
3
Pinch the metal band that goes across the nose piece of the mask until it fits.
-
4
Face forward and keep your chin level with the floor during the nebulizer treatment. Turning your head or dropping your head creates gaps in the fit of the mask, which allows the medication to escape before you can inhale it.

Tips & Warnings
Let children decorate the exterior of their nebulizer face mask with permanent marker to personalize it
Clean the mask and the nebulizer machine thoroughly after every treatment.
Replace the mask if the metal nose band breaks or if the mask cracks or breaks.
